Perioperative cytokine profile during lung surgery predicts patients at risk for postoperative complications-A prospective, clinical study.
<h4>Background</h4>Postoperative complications after lung surgery are frequent, having a detrimental effect on patients' further course. Complications may lead to an increased length of hospital stay and cause additional costs. Several risk factors have been identified but it is sti...
